Peningkatan Kesadaran Keamanan Data dan Jaringan Melalui Webinar dan Workshop
Abstract
Public Wi-Fi users in Indonesia remain largely unaware of how easily unencrypted traffic exposes their login credentials, a gap that has enabled data theft and fraudulent online loan applications filed under stolen identities. This community service activity, part of the KKN Diseminasi Magang dan Studi Independen Bersertifikat Batch 10 program, aimed to raise data and network security awareness among students and teachers from three partner schools, SMA Dewan Dakwah Bekasi, MTsN 24 Jakarta Timur, and SMK Perguruan Cikini Jakarta, along with the general public. The team carried out four stages: a needs analysis of the partner schools, preparation of teaching materials and event administration, a one-day online webinar and workshop held via Zoom on 27 June 2026, and an evaluation using pre-test, post-test, and feedback instruments. Of 98 registrants, 53 participants completed the full session. Material covered network threats, the HTTP/HTTPS distinction, encryption and hashing, public-network attack techniques, a Wireshark-based sniffing demonstration, Have I Been Pwned checks, and two-step verification. Average scores rose from 82.68 before the session to 93.45 afterward, a gain of 10.77 points, while feedback showed most participants rated the material's relevance and delivery highly. These results indicate that pairing conceptual explanation with hands-on demonstration measurably improved participants' understanding of public network security risks.
